Wyo. Stat. Ann. § 4-10-401

Methods of creating trust

(a) A trust may be created by:

(i) Transfer of property to another person as trustee during the settlor's lifetime or by will or other disposition taking effect upon the settlor's death;

(ii) Declaration by the owner of property that the owner holds identifiable property as trustee;

(iii) Exercise of a power of appointment in favor of a trustee;

(iv) The court as provided in W.S. 3-3-607(a)(vi); or (v) An agent under a power of attorney where the express authority is designated with the appointment document and where the trust directs distribution upon the settlor's death consistent with an existing will or other testamentary instrument or in absence thereof in accordance with the law of intestate succession as provided in W.S. 2-4-101.
